Table 4.
DIC model selection results for the δ13C, δ15N, δ34S stable isotope (CNS) Bayesian mixing models (MixSIAR) used to estimate diets of leopard seals based on stable isotope values from plasma and red blood cells (RBC) sampled from seals at Cape Shirreff, Livingston Island in 2013, 2014, and 2017 (n = 23)
| Model | DIC | ∆DIC | Median variance (σ) |
|---|---|---|---|
| CNSplasma ~ (1|Year) | 32.77379 | – | σyear = 0.772 |
| CNSplasma ~ Sex + (1|Year) | 33.85499 | 1.0812 |
σyear = 0.911 σSex = 1.684 |
| CNSplasma ~ (1|Year/Seal ID) | 40.84313 | 8.0693 |
σyear = 0.753 σSeal ID = 0.103 |
| CNSplasma ~ Mass + (1|Year) | 45.78776 | 13.014 |
σyear = 0.764 σMass = 0.091 |
| CNSRBC ~ (1|Year) | 29.58741 | – | σyear = 0.193 |
| CNSRBC ~ Sex + (1|Year) | 32.38981 | 2.8024 |
σyear = 0.210 σSex = 0.281 |
| CNSRBC ~ Mass + (1|Year) | 39.74659 | 10.1592 |
σyear = 0.195 σMass = 0.063 |
| CNSRBC ~ (1|Year/Seal ID) | 107.9329 | 78.3455 |
σyear = 0.178 σSeal ID = 0.134 |
Median variance (σ) reflects the 50% quantiles of variance for each model effect. Year and seal ID were random effects, sex was a fixed effect, and mass was a continuous effect
CNSplasma: plasma tissue, CNSRBC: red blood cell tissue
